the area of a circle is 25π square feet. what is the radius? give the exact answer in simplest form. feet
Step1: Write the formula for the area of a circle
The formula for the area of a circle is \( A=\pi r^{2} \), where \( A \) is the area and \( r \) is the radius.
Step2: Substitute the given area into the formula
Given \( A = 25\pi \), we substitute into \( A=\pi r^{2} \):
\( 25\pi=\pi r^{2} \)
Step3: Solve for \( r^{2} \)
Divide both sides of the equation \( 25\pi=\pi r^{2} \) by \( \pi \):
\( \frac{25\pi}{\pi}=\frac{\pi r^{2}}{\pi} \), which simplifies to \( 25 = r^{2} \).
Step4: Solve for \( r \)
Take the square root of both sides. Since \( r>0 \) (radius is a non - negative quantity), \( r=\sqrt{25} \).
